DCAS/Facilities Management & Construction (FMC) manages operates and maintains 55 City-owned buildings throughout the five boroughs working to provide clean safe and energy efficient space for the tenants in these public buildings.
FMC is dedicated to both the daily maintenance of the public buildings managed by Building Services Fire & Life Safety and other critical field staff as well as to long-term renovation and rehabilitation projects which are managed by a dedicated staff of architects engineers and other professional technical experts. FMC also oversees the daily operations of all elevators across the DCAS public buildings portfolio.
Mechanical Maintenance and Operations - responsible for the preventive maintenance repair and operation of the installed mechanical systems in the DCAS portfolio. This includes heating ventilation and air conditioning equipment backup electrical generators fire suppression and domestic water supply.

SENIOR STATIONARY ENGINEER - 91638
Qualifications :
1. One year of full-time experience as Stationary Engineer in charge of a high pressure plant supervising at least three stationary engineers in the operation maintenance and adjustment of high-pressure boilers; and
2. A valid License for High Pressure Boiler Operating Engineer issued by the New York City Department of Buildings.
